--On Wednesday, May 12, 2021 18:57 +0200 Alessandro Vesely <vesely@tana.it> wrote: >... >>> This is well understood technology - see any company that >>> intercepts https:// and re-encrypts the user-side traffic >>> using their own keys.> >> or DKIM. > Neither case provides for end-to-end crypto. (Hm... possibly > except DKIM for postmaster to postmaster communication, > deploying the binary key as OpenGPG. Not an alluring > technique.) And, getting back to the point that John Levine, myself, and others have been trying to make, there is a world (or at least several orders of magnitude) of difference between keys associated with hosts (mail servers, firewall gateways, web sites, etc.) and those associated with individual users or mailbox names. best, john
